Utf8 encoder.
- Utf8 encoder Experience the convenience and efficiency of our UTF-8 Encode tool today, and take the complexity out of character encoding. This makes UTF-8 ideal if backwards compatibility is required with existing ASCII text. . Mar 31, 2014 · A Unicode-based encoding such as UTF-8 can support many languages and can accommodate pages and forms in any mixture of those languages. This makes it a sound choice for use in internationalized software. TextEncoder. Rise to Dominance. In UTF-8, ASCII characters are encoded using their raw byte equivalents. Mojibake has mostly become a thing of the past, because most websites and software now use UTF-8 by default. In fact, since Python 3. für 8-Bit UCS Transformation Format, wobei UCS wiederum Universal Character Set abkürzt) ist die am weitesten verbreitete Kodierung für Unicode-Zeichen (Unicode und UCS sind praktisch identisch). Quick and powerful! UTF8 to ASCII Converter Examples Second, UTF-8 is an encoding standard to encode Unicode string to bytes. The following function will utf-8 encode unicode entities &#nnn(nn); with n={0. This tool uses utf8. This tool can be used auto-detect your file encoding. e. No ads, nonsense, or garbage. UTF-8 is a variable-length character encoding for Unicode, also known as Universal Code. euc-jp URL Encode online. If there is only one byte, its highest binary bit is 0; String encoding and decoding converter. UTF-8, a variable length encoding method in which one represents each written symbol- to four-byte code, and UTF-16, a fixed width encoding scheme in which a two-byte code represents each written symbol, are the two most prevalent Unicode implementations for computer systems. Other characters require anywhere from 2-4 bytes. Convert plain text to utf-8 codes and vice versa. Perform URL-safe encoding (uses Base64URL format). UTF-8 can encode all possible characters, or code points, in Unicode. Import UTF8 – get URL-escaped UTF8. Encoding basics. Mar 13, 2009 · UTF-8 is a variable width character encoding capable of encoding all 1,112,064 valid code points in Unicode using one to four 8-bit bytes. UTF-8 is also the recommendation from the WHATWG for HTML and DOM specifications, and stating "UTF-8 encoding is the most appropriate encoding for interchange of Unicode" [4] and the Internet Mail Consortium recommends that all e‑mail programs be able to display and create mail using UTF-8. World's simplest browser-based UTF8 URL-encoder. Extract code points, convert UTF8 to binary, octal, decimal, hex, base-64 and URL-encode UTF8, and more. So UTF-8 is as efficient as ASCII in terms of space. Also, you can use this program to verify the given UTF8 has been correctly encoded. But back in the day, mojibake was apparently such a common problem that they invented a word for it! Other tools. Free, quick, and very powerful. Online Utf-8 converter, easy to use utf-8 encoding and decoder tool. HTML Escape / URL Encoding / Quoted-printable / and many other formats! The following tool takes this into account and offers to choose between the ASCII character encoding table and the UTF-8 character encoding table. Big offset numbers when encoding or decoding to HEX or BIN can lead to overflow. Apr 19, 2023 · Avant de voir comment encoder un fichier en UTF-8, voyons pourquoi il est utile d’utiliser l’UTF-8. Whether you're a developer, programmer, or web designer, this tool makes it easy to convert text to UTF-8 encoding or decode UTF-8 data back into readable text. · decimal · hex. Supports a wide range of characters and languages. To convert your input to UTF-8, this tool splits the input data into individual graphemes (letters, numbers, emojis, and special Unicode symbols), then it extracts code points of all graphemes, and then turns them into UTF-8 byte values in the Sep 10, 2020 · UTF-8 encoder/decoder. UTF-8 is a compromise character encoding that can be as compact as ASCII (if the file is just plain English text) but can also contain any unicode characters (with some increase in file size). Sep 9, 2019 · The UTF-8 encoding scheme could be extended to allow n = 4, 5, or 6, but this is unnecessary. ). js to UTF-8-encode any string you enter in the ‘decoded’ field, or to decode any UTF-8-encoded string you enter in the ‘encoded’ field. Akto's UTF-8 Encoder effortlessly converts Unicode characters into UTF-8 byte sequences. Python has excellent built-in support for UTF-8. Jun 14, 2024 · UTF-8 and Unicode. UTF-8 uses a variable length encoding especially on high code point, so it hard to determine the number of UTF8 bytes. When the client sends data to your server and they are using UTF-8 , they are sending a bunch of bytes not str . Are there other encoding systems besides UTF-8? There are other encoding systems for Unicode besides UTF-8, but UTF-8 is unique because it represents characters in one-byte units. URLEncoder is a simple and easy to use online tool to convert any string to URL Encoded format in real time. But for other characters, it will use the first bit to indicate that a 2nd byte will UTF-8 is the dominant encoding of the World Wide Web, so your code is likely encoded with this standard. UTF8 allows only specific byte sequences and if the bytes have errors, then you'll see them output here. Initially used in Plan 9, UTF-8 gained widespread adoption through the growth of Linux and the internet. UTF-8 lets you take an ordinary ASCII file and consider it a Unicode file encoded with UTF-8. Unicode Converter enables you to easily convert Unicode characters in UTF-16, UTF-8, and UTF-32 formats to their Unicode and decimal representations. Split lines into 76 character wide chunks (useful for MIME). UTF-8 encoding rules. Works with ASCII and Unicode strings. Each ASCII character results in a single byte in the output. UTF8 Decode helps to decode utf8 to text. Encode and Decode UTF-8 Text Online. utf-8 utf-8 ↖. UTF-8 stands for "Unicode Transformation Format - 8-bit" What are some usage of UTF8 Encoding? Online tool to encode text (String) to utf-8 and decode utf-8 back to text (String) Online UTF-8 Encoder And Decoder Tool UTF-8 (Unicode Transformation-8-bit) is an character encoding defined by the International Organization for Standardization (ISO) which enables us to encode every possible character code points to unicode. Whether you are working with web pages, databases Feb 14, 2025 · UTF-8 is a highly efficient, flexible, and universally adopted character encoding system that enables the representation of virtually every character used in modern languages and systems. Nov 17, 2018 · Cons of UTF8 encoding. big5 ↖. Encode and decode strings: Base64, URL, XML, JavaScript. 9} /** * takes a string of unicode entities and converts it to a utf-8 encoded string May 1, 2024 · UTF-8, UTF-16 and UTF-32 are encodings that apply the Unicode character table. UTF-16 , ASCII , SHIFT-JIS , etc. I hope you've found this helpful. This is potentially more performant than the older encode Jul 24, 2020 · Python3 encode()方法 描述 encode() 方法以指定的编码格式编码字符串。errors参数可以指定不同的错误处理方案。 语法 encode()方法语法: str. Unicode uses various encoding schemes to represent characters, including UTF-8, UTF-16, and UTF-32. A simple online UTF8 encoder and decoder, for developers and programmers. View hexadecimal, binary, and Unicode representations of UTF-8 encoded text. Standard 7-bit ASCII characters are always encoded as a single byte in UTF-8. Decode UTF-8 encoded text effortlessly and ensure seamless communication and compatibility across different systems and platforms. Dec 6, 2020 · With the UTF-8 encoding, 2,097,152 characters can be encoded, which is almost 15 times the current number of Unicode characters. Efficiency. encodeInto() Takes a string to encode and a destination Uint8Array to put resulting UTF-8 encoded text into, and returns an object indicating the progress of the encoding. Apr 3, 2022 · UTF-8 is a Sound Choice for Encoding. UTF stands for Unicode Transformation Format. Require encoding module for programming languages. Perfect for developers working with character encoding and internationalization. Online UTF-8 encoding and decoding tool. Since there is a lot of complexity and some sort of learning curve is involved, most of the users end up using an online UTF-8 encoder and decoder tool to get the job done as soon as possible. Unicode Transformation Format 8-bit is a variable-width encoding that can represent every character in the Unicode character set. Load form URL, Download, Save and Share. UTF-8 (abréviation de l'anglais Universal Character Set Transformation Format [1] - 8 bits) est un codage de caractères informatiques conçu pour coder l’ensemble des caractères du « répertoire universel de caractères codés », initialement développé par l’ISO dans la norme internationale ISO/CEI 10646, aujourd’hui totalement compatible avec le standard Unicode, en restant Python encode()方法 Python 字符串 描述 Python encode() 方法以 encoding 指定的编码格式编码字符串。 errors参数可以指定不同的错误处理方案。 语法 encode()方法语法: str. UTF-8 is a variable-width(meaning codes of different lengths are used to encode a character representation) character encoding. Created by geeks from team Browserling. This is potentially more performant than the older encode() method — especially when the target buffer is a view into a Wasm heap. UTF-8 (8-bit Unicode Transformation Format) is a variable length character encoding that can encode any of the valid Unicode characters. It was designed for backward compatibility with ASCII and to avoid the complications of endianness and byte order marks in UTF-16 and UTF-32. Text Transformation: They transform plain text, including characters and symbols, into a format that guarantees multilingual support and compatibility UTF-8 encoding online tool. Simplify your work with Unicode data using our free UTF-8 Encoder/Decoder. Unfortunately, it might be inaccurate as some characters are shared between sets and might just not be present in the file. Sep 25, 2024 · TextEncoder. 0, UTF-8 has been the default source encoding. By 2009, it became the most common character encoding for the World Wide Web, surpassing both ASCII and other Unicode encodings. For example, if your source viewer only supports Windows-1252, but the page is encoded as UTF-8, you can select text from your source viewer, paste it here, and see what the characters really are. UTF-8 encodes UNICODE characters in 1 to 6 bytes. Aug 7, 2022 · UTF-8 is a byte encoding used to encode unicode characters. This means that you can use Unicode characters directly in your Python code without any special notation. The first byte uses one to five most significant bits 2 to indicate the number of bytes to follow: Encoding and decoding UTF-8 can be time-consuming, especially when you don’t have enough knowledge about UTF-8 encoding and decoding. Our UTF-8 Encoder/Decoder is a free online tool that allows you to easily convert text to UTF-8 encoded format and decode UTF-8 back to plain text. Si votre texte n'est pas codé en ISO-8859-1, vous n'avez pas besoin de cette fonction. It helps to convert UTF8 to String. Discover how it works and explore its practical use cases. encode(encoding='UTF-8',errors='strict') 参数 encoding --要使用的编码,如: UTF-8。 UTF-8 encoding: hex. Remember, a unicode character is represented by a unicode code point. Coder’s Toolbox. Aug 5, 2020 · If, instead, every Unicode character was represented by four bytes, a text file written in English would be four times the size of the same file encoded with UTF-8. For SMS messages, Twilio uses the most compact encoding method available. Try Akto's UTF-8 Encoder today! UTF8 Encoder/Decoder. encode() Takes a string as input, and returns a Uint8Array containing UTF-8 encoded text. With the UTF8 Encode tool, you can easily convert your text to UTF-8 encoding for use in these systems and applications. It remains relevant because it allows computers to store and transmit text in a way that a wide range of devices and applications can understand. Press a button – get UTF8. encodeInto() method takes a string to encode and a destination Uint8Array to put resulting UTF-8 encoded text into, and returns a dictionary object indicating the progress of the encoding. Tool to explore encoding and decoding between Unicode and other encodings. Unicode characters to encode: Convert. UTF-8 est un système d’encodage universel qui permet aux ordinateurs de comprendre et d’afficher les caractères de toutes les langues, y compris les écritures non latines telles que l’arabe, le chinois et le cyrillique. Decode UTF-8 strings with ease using Akto's Decoder for efficient web development, data storage, and file interchange. Simply copy and paste your text in the form field below and see the UTF-8 data on the right. But not in terms of time. Simply input your text, choose to encode or decode, and get instant results. It translates characters to numbers. World's simplest online UTF8 encoder for web developers and programmers. 0 names: links for adding char to text: displayed · not displayed: numerical HTML encoding of the Unicode character UTF8 URL Encoder World's Simplest UTF8 Tool. With this utility, you can generate various test cases for Unicode and ASCII form data in UTF8 encoding. The number "8" in UTF-8 means that 8-bit numbers (single-byte numbers) are used in the encoding. utf8_encode : Convertit une chaîne ISO-8859-1 en UTF-8 Comme le dit le top commentaire de php. Its use also eliminates the need for server-side logic to individually determine the character encoding for each page served or each incoming form submission. Live mode OFF Encodes in real-time as you type or paste (supports only the UTF-8 character set). Character Encoding: UTF-8 Encoders are used to encode text characters into their corresponding UTF-8 representations, making it possible to display, store, and transmit text in diverse languages. Again, UTF-8 is a super efficient encoding system. In addition, you can percent encode/decode URL parameters and encode text to Base64. A character in UTF-8 encoding takes from 1 to 4 bytes. For example, this tool will allow you to change the encoding of your file from ISO-8859-1 to UTF-8 or from UTF-8 to UTF-16. Jan 14, 2025 · How to Implement UTF-8 Encoding in Your Code UTF-8 Encoding in Python. UTF-8 (Abk. Twilio defaults to GSM-7 and falls back to UCS-2 if your message contains any non-GSM-7 characters. UTF-8 encoding will store "hello" like this (binary): 01101000 01100101 01101100 01101100 01101111. UTF8. But they each have a slightly different way on how to encode them. UTF8 consume more processing time to find sequence code unit because UTF-8 uses a variable length encoding. Just import your UTF8 string in the editor on the left and you will instantly get percent-encoded characters on the right. Encode UTF-8 characters into binary, hexadecimal, or decimal numbers with an optional signed byte offset. It also contains several articles on how to URL Encode a query string or form parameter in different programming languages. Note: If you know how UTF-8 and UTF-16 are encoded, skip to the next section for practical applications. All the other tools on this website automatically detect text encoding and return their output in UTF-8. You can also decode an encoded message into UTF-8 characters, with an optional signed byte offset. Introduction to UTF-8. UTF-8: For the standard ASCII (0-127) characters, the UTF-8 codes are identical. Perfect for developers working with internationalization, data processing, or troubleshooting character encoding issues. To elaborate: Unicode is a standard, which defines a map from characters to numbers, the so-called code points , (like in the example below). encode(encoding='UTF-8',errors='strict') 参数 encoding -- 要使用的编码,如“UTF-8”。 Because UTF8 is a multi-byte encoding, there can be one to four bytes per UTF8 character and as a result there can be up to four ASCII characters per UTF8 character. Unicode is a character set. UTF-8 is the most commonly used encoding scheme and provides backward compatibility with ASCII, the widely used character encoding standard for the English language. What can you do with UTF8 Encoder? This tool helps you to convert your TEXT or HTML data to UTF8 encoded String/Data. Why is UTF8 Encode relevant today? UTF-8 is a character encoding format that is widely used today. Just paste your text in the form below, press the UTF8 Encode button, and you'll get UTF8-encoded data. ENCODE Encodes your data into the area below. Sep 25, 2024 · The TextEncoder. It can represent a wide range of characters while still being compatible with ASCII. Explore the power of UTF-8 decoding with Akto's Decoder tool. The Evolution of UTF-8 and Why It Matters Whether you're encoding special characters, emojis, or foreign language characters, our UTF-8 Encode tool ensures accuracy and reliability, empowering you to handle text encoding effortlessly. Its backward compatibility with ASCII, variable-length structure, and support for a wide range of characters make it the preferred encoding for the internet UTF-8 interpreted as Windows-1252 Raw UTF-8 encoded text, but interpreted as Windows-1252. UTF-8 is a popular encoding format used in a wide range of systems and applications. Each Unicode character is encoded using 1-4 bytes. There are many encoding standards out there (e. Jun 18, 2018 · UTF-8 is the most popular unicode encoding format that can represent text in any language. g. (0x) · octal · binary · for Perl string literals · One Latin-1 char per byte · no display: Unicode character names: not displayed · displayed · also display deprecated Unicode 1. Made by @mathias — fork this on GitHub! Convert text to UTF-8 encoding with our UTF-8 Encoder/Decoder tool. UTF-8 uses 1, 2, 3 or 4 bytes to represent a unicode character. net, un nom plus approprié pour cette fonction serait « iso88591_to_utf8 ». The Unicode converter doesn't automatically add spaces between the converted values. If you opt for the ASCII character encoding table, a warning message will pop up if the URL encoded/decoded text contains non-ASCII characters. World's simplest collection of useful UTF8 utilities. UTF-8 will only use 1 byte when encoding an ASCII character, giving the same output as any other ASCII encoding. Time conversion · String conversion Target character set: N one US-A SCII ISO-8859-1 The UTF8 Encode tool is a simple but powerful tool for converting text to UTF-8 encoding. Encode each line separately (useful for when you have multiple entries). vixodr dggk laae ytfp hpnqh swqp vihlmx fhjf eczaf cquxv yfr bxjlypt galbyq jbn ttx